No to the Bronco and I am a diehard Ford guy. It will be a first year model and no one will be selling them even close to MSRP after dealer fees are added. Just to many unknowns plus it looks like an early 70's International Scout. I managed to get a hefty discount on the Rubicon. Wranglers hold their value amazingly well.

Mods? Not many, mostly cosmetic. The reason I went with the Rubicon is it has lockers front and rear, 4:10 gears, and 33 inch tires from the factory. But I'm not kidding myself, this will be mostly a mall crawler with occasional light trail use.
